Heater blower blew and now nothing works

My 79 C10 just couldn't be happy with that new trans last week. The heater blower blew yesterday and nothing works. No lights, no engine turn over, nothing. The wires from the heater fan were cooked. I guess there was a problem of metal to wire, after I replaced the old fan back. Now I have a new battery and still no power, nothing. All the fuses look good, the resistor by the blower doesn't look good. I thought I might replace the ignition coil. I just can't imagine that the blower line is hijacking my hole electric system. My guess is a fusable link. Follow your output cable till you locate a plastic "bump" and verify voltage from there.

X2 More than likely your wiring killed your fan your fan didn't kill your wiring. Check your fusable links. Also try and track down where you problem is, swapping in a new link will just cause it to blow again if you don't find your problem.

One of the fusable link wires going to the starter solenoid was a mess. I dropped the starter today, and tomorrow I will test the solenoid and starter. I will build up some more wires for the fusable links and put the starter back in place. I also will replace the heater fan wires and replace the fan as well. Just in time for some cold weather.
